Top-Five Quarterbacks in America: Coveted LSU Football Target Arrives for Official Visit


Introduction

The 2025 college football recruiting cycle has been marked by intense competition for top-tier quarterback talent. Among the most coveted prospects is Bryce Underwood, a five-star quarterback from Belleville, Michigan. Underwood’s recruitment has been closely followed by LSU, which views him as a cornerstone for its future offensive strategy. His recent official visit to LSU has intensified discussions about his potential fit within the Tigers’ program.(Rivals)

1. Bryce Underwood (Michigan)

  • High School: Belleville High School, Michigan
  • Height/Weight: 6’4″, 208 lbs
  • Stats: Over 40 touchdowns and only two interceptions in his junior season.
  • Accolades: Two-time Michigan Gatorade Player of the Year, Michigan Mr. Football (2024).(Wikipedia, On3)

Underwood’s combination of arm strength, mobility, and football intelligence has made him the consensus No. 1 overall recruit in the 2025 class. His recent commitment to Michigan has shifted the balance of power in the Big Ten, but LSU remains a program to watch in his recruitment.
